Why North Carolina Is a Strategic Place for Motivated Entrepreneurs

Few regions balance affordability, innovation, and community like North Carolina. It’s a state where big dreams don’t require Silicon Valley budgets. Entrepreneurs here benefit from a blend of low operating costs, supportive business networks, and statewide incentives.

The NC IDEA Foundation offers grants that help startups scale. Research Triangle Park fosters collaboration between innovators, investors, and universities. From Charlotte’s finance hub to Wilmington’s creative scene, each city provides unique entrepreneurial soil.

There’s also a cultural magnetism at play, North Carolina values authenticity. It celebrates the underdog entrepreneur who starts small and scales with intention. Motivated founders thrive because the state’s ecosystem rewards courage, not just capital.

Stories of success echo across the state. From a Durham tech founder turning a garage project into a venture-backed company to a Winston-Salem small business scaling through micro-investments, North Carolina has become a living blueprint of startup evolution.

From Motivation to Action: How to Channel That Energy into Investment

Validate the Idea & Market

Start by testing your concept. Talk to potential customers, refine your product, and gauge demand before pouring money in. Motivation without validation can lead to burnout. Use surveys, prototype feedback, or small pilot launches to confirm market fit.

Build a Lean Plan / Forecast

A business plan is your GPS, it turns abstract ideas into actionable strategy. Keep it lean but precise. Include projections, cost estimates, and growth targets. This clarity doesn’t just guide you, it attracts investors who crave structured thinking.

Start Small, Bootstrap or Seed

The myth of “needing big capital to start” often kills great ideas. Begin lean. Many small investment business models thrive on efficiency, not excess. North Carolina’s ecosystem encourages local entrepreneurs to bootstrap with minimal risk before seeking outside funding.

Seek Local Investors / Grants / Angel Groups in NC

Funding opportunities flourish in North Carolina. Programs like NC IDEA, Hustle Winston-Salem, and local angel groups provide early-stage backing. Investors here are approachable and community-driven, motivated founders who demonstrate passion and planning often catch their attention.

Scale & Reinforce Motivation Through Milestones

Success is addictive when tracked properly. Each small milestone, first customer, first investor, first hire, fuels momentum. Celebrate them. It’s how motivation stays alive and how your business naturally attracts continued investment.

FAQs

Q: How much capital do I need to start investing in my NC business?
A: Many North Carolina startups launch with under $5,000. Bootstrap initially, test your market, and expand through local grants or microloans.

Q: Can motivation alone help me secure investors?
A: Motivation opens doors, but credibility closes deals. Pair passion with clear metrics, user validation, and achievable forecasts to attract investors.

Q: What NC-specific resources help motivated entrepreneurs?
A: Programs like NC IDEA, SBTDC, and RTP’s accelerator network provide mentorship, grants, and seed funding for early-stage founders.

Q: How can I sustain motivation through setbacks?
A: Reconnect with your “why,” recalibrate your goals, and engage peer accountability. Momentum returns when reflection meets action.

Q: When should I move from motivation to investment?
A: Transition once you’ve validated your product, proven demand, and developed an actionable financial model, start small, scale steadily.
